Title: * G999/CI-18-41 All Commission Rate Regulated Natural Gas Utilities In the Matter of a Commission Investigation into Natural Gas Utilities' Practices, Tariffs and Assignment of Cost Responsibility for Installation of Excess Flow Valves and Other Similar Gas Safety Equipment. Should the Commission approve the proposed excess flow valve (EFV) tariffs? Should the Commission accept the proposed customer notices as substantially compliant with 49 C.F.R. ? 192.383? Should the Commission accept the utility specific payment plans for customer requested installation of an EFV on an existing natural gas service line? Should the Commission determine that the rate regulated natural gas utilities have complied with all of the filing requirements of the Commission investigation and close the docket? (PUC: Bonnett)
